# Break-Glass: Catalog Cache Invalidation

Scope: the Pinrow product catalog at Veldstone Retail. If stale prices persist after a purge and the Hollowmere invalidation queue is wedged, use break-glass to flush the edge tier directly. Contractors: get verbal sign-off from the catalog lead first. Steps: open the Hollowmere admin shell, select emergency-flush, confirm the tenant, and run it once — repeated flushes thrash the origin. Access is logged and expires after 20 minutes. Unseal the admin shell with the passphrase below.

recovery phrase for kahop-tajog: istix-casvan

**Minutes — Management Meeting, Arbett & Sons**

Prepared for the incoming director. The committee confirmed closure of the Netherfold satellite office. Three staff will transfer to the Grayston site; one has accepted voluntary redundancy. The lease expires in March, and fixtures will be sold via auction. Costs are within the approved envelope. The underlying business rationale is set out immediately below.

board note of kagep-yahig: Only 9 of the 120 pilot accounts renewed Quenix, so a churn review is set for April 1.

/*
 * Client setup for the Coinbridge conversion service.
 * Background for support: we previously saw rounding errors when
 * converting between currencies with different minor-unit scales —
 * amounts were rounded per leg instead of once at the end, causing
 * one-cent discrepancies in customer statements. The client now
 * carries full precision internally and rounds only on display.
 * If a ticket mentions off-by-one-cent totals, check the client
 * version first. Requests authenticate with the key below.
 */

service key, fawip-bajef: kto11_Qt5wZK9vdNC

**Q: Where do guests get Wi-Fi access at the Larkspur House office?**

All visitors must check in at the guest Wi-Fi desk to the left of the main reception counter. The receptionist will issue a day pass valid until 18:00. Guests cannot connect to the staff network under any circumstances. If you are escorting a visitor, you must remain with them while credentials are issued. To open the reception inner door and reach the desk, use the pass code below.

turnstile pass: bdg-NG-3